Iran-Backed Hackers Breach FBI Director Kash Patel’s Personal Email, Leaking Private Documents
\n\n
In a brazen cyberattack that underscores the escalating threat of state-sponsored espionage, Iran-linked hackers have successfully breached the personal email account of FBI Director Kash Patel. The sophisticated cybercriminal group publicly released a trove of the director’s private information, including his personal photographs, sensitive digital communications, and his resume. This high-profile leak has sent shockwaves through the US intelligence community, exposing potential digital vulnerabilities even at the absolute highest echelons of federal law enforcement.
\n\n
The FBI has swiftly responded to the incident, confirming the intrusion while emphasizing that the breach was contained to Patel’s personal, rather than government-secured, communication channels. Although official classified networks appear to remain intact, the weaponization of a top intelligence chief’s private data represents a bold psychological and symbolic victory for the Iranian-backed operatives. Cybersecurity experts warn that this targeted hack is likely part of a broader, aggressive campaign by foreign adversaries designed to harass, intimidate, and gather leverage on prominent American officials.
\n\n
As federal authorities and cybersecurity teams scramble to mitigate the fallout and assess the full scope of the digital intrusion, the breach serves as a glaring wake-up call regarding the relentless tactics of state-aligned threat actors. The incident is currently under intense federal investigation to determine precisely how the hackers bypassed security protocols and to ensure no further sensitive intelligence remains at risk.
